Output dbb459c57bc3fcd3f1d6bfbce2872515469837b3f22dbc3cfafa86122588943b:2

value
99523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b1d085151fcaa9bca33bea2b577c65681fd739 OP_EQUAL
address
3KXkhimGCqkumU3LU3ZztSe2iEvwjEm1uE
transaction
dbb459c57bc3fcd3f1d6bfbce2872515469837b3f22dbc3cfafa86122588943b
confirmations
155905
spent
true